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ree (BS) in mathematics, statistics, machine learning, physics, computer science, or other scientific disciplines
  • Up to 3 years of professional experience OR actively pursuing a BS or MS (expected graduation date: 2025 or 2026)
  • Demonstrated proficiency in quantitative analysis and problem-solving
  • Proficiency in Python programming
  • Prior experience tackling data-intensive challenges and conducting statistical or applied mathematical research
  • Successful participation in mathematical competitions (e.g., IMO, Putnam) - a plus
  • Prior experience in a quantitative role within a trading environment - a plus
  • Intellectually curious, creative, and rigorous
  • Willingness to challenge assumptions and revise opinions in the face of compelling evidence
  • Self-motivated and highly productive, with a strong sense of urgency and accountability
  • Willing to take ownership of one’s work, working both independently and within a small team
  • Meticulous attention to detail
  • Ability to manage and prioritize multiple threads of work
  • Able to work across disciplines
  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ills

Responsibilities

  • Collaborate closely with a team to develop and implement quantitative trading signals, models, and strategies
  • Design, implement, and evaluate research systems components using rigorous statistical methodologies
  • Gain exposure to diverse research areas, accelerating expertise in quantitative finance

About Aquatic Capital Management

Aquatic Capital Management specializes in quantitative investment management, focusing on creating financial models that predict market movements. The company uses advanced research and development techniques, employing a team of skilled researchers and engineers to develop data-driven investment strategies for institutional clients like hedge funds and pension funds. Aquatic's products work by leveraging mathematical models and algorithms to analyze market data and generate insights that help clients maximize their returns. Unlike many competitors, Aquatic operates without the limitations of outdated systems, allowing for greater agility and responsiveness to market changes. The company's goal is to build the best prediction machine in the industry while fostering a collaborative and innovative workplace culture that attracts top talent.
